Republican J.D. Hayworth, the former congressman who is challenging U.S. Sen. John McCain this year, stopped by Arizona Illustrated yesterday. Anchor Bill Buckmaster was kind enough to let me join him in questioning Hayworth. He talks about McCain’s record, waterboarding, the birther controversy and his vote to expand health-care entitlements during the Bush administration.
